Handover: Exportron retry queue

Hi Mira — handing over the failed-export retries. Exports that hit a timeout land in the retry queue and get three attempts with backoff; after that they're parked and need a manual requeue from the admin panel. Watch for customers reporting duplicates — that usually means a double requeue. The current retry settings are as follows.

settings of bajog-fawig:
oliael:
  log_level: warn
  metrics_host: metrics.oliael.zemvarsys.internal
  pin: 0267
  pool_size: 32

Handover for the Brindlewood gateway work: I've moved the health-check endpoint off the main request path so the Varngate load balancer probes a lightweight route that skips auth middleware. Note the probe interval is 5s with a 2-failure threshold, so any deploy longer than 10s will drain nodes — the rollout script now staggers restarts accordingly. Please double-check the readiness logic around the cache warmup flag. The full probe configuration rationale is documented on the internal page here.

operations page: https://jira.qorvelsys.internal/browse/pages/browse/pages

## Onboarding: Inkmill review setup

Inkmill is our markdown rendering pipeline. Reviewers need local access to the preview service to verify rendered output against fixtures. Clone the repo, run the bootstrap script, then export the preview token before starting the dev server. Tokens are reviewer-scoped and read-only; rotation is handled centrally. Do not commit it anywhere. The key you'll need is below.

API key for yahig-tadup: kto7_ubizbYm

**Release checklist — Prosewatch doc linter v4**

- [ ] All lint rules pass on the Kestrel handbook corpus, zero suppressions added this cycle.
- [ ] New heading-depth rule validated against the Orlo style guide samples.
- [ ] Changelog entry reviewed and merged.
- [ ] Binary reproducibility check: rebuild twice, hashes must match.
- [ ] Rollback plan confirmed with the docs platform rotation.

Reviewer: do not approve until the verification pipeline emits the build token shown below.

pipeline stamp: htk9_ce63042d9